How does the camera arrange the halo?

The lens of a camera is usually designed and processed to prevent the occurrence of halo, so as not to affect the imaging quality. However, when the strong point light source directly shoots at the lens, it will produce halo effect and interfere with the normal work of the camera metering system. Usually, it is necessary to increase the exposure by 2~4 levels according to the strength of the point light source to have the required shooting effect.
